How this band is built

The band is the published envelope over used and refurbished listings that clear our floor checks, weighted by source reliability and recency. It is a market read, not a quote: your price depends on condition, quantity, and timing.

Buying a used RTX A6000, answered

As of August 1, 2026, a used RTX A6000 48GB sells for $3,800 to $4,800 on the secondary market. The spread reflects condition and seller type: documented, tested units sit near the top, unknown-history pulls near the bottom. Every figure is computed from observed data, not a sticker price.
